// findQueryPos searches fset for filename and translates the
// specified file-relative byte offsets into token.Pos form.  It
// returns an error if the file was not found or the offsets were out
// of bounds.
//
func findQueryPos(fset *token.FileSet, filename string, startOffset, endOffset int) (start, end token.Pos, err error) {
	var file *token.File
	fset.Iterate(func(f *token.File) bool {
		if sameFile(filename, f.Name()) {
			// (f.Name() is absolute)
			file = f
			return false // done
		}
		return true // continue
	})
	if file == nil {
		err = fmt.Errorf("couldn't find file containing position")
		return
	}

	// Range check [start..end], inclusive of both end-points.

	if 0 <= startOffset && startOffset <= file.Size() {
		start = file.Pos(int(startOffset))
	} else {
		err = fmt.Errorf("start position is beyond end of file")
		return
	}

	if 0 <= endOffset && endOffset <= file.Size() {
		end = file.Pos(int(endOffset))
	} else {
		err = fmt.Errorf("end position is beyond end of file")
		return
	}

	return
}

// parseQueryPos parses a string of the form "file:pos" or
// file:start,end" where pos, start, end match #%d and represent byte
// offsets, and returns the extent to which it refers.
//
// (Numbers without a '#' prefix are reserved for future use,
// e.g. to indicate line/column positions.)
//
func parseQueryPos(fset *token.FileSet, queryPos string) (start, end token.Pos, err error) {
	if queryPos == "" {
		err = fmt.Errorf("no source position specified (-pos flag)")
		return
	}

	colon := strings.LastIndex(queryPos, ":")
	if colon < 0 {
		err = fmt.Errorf("invalid source position -pos=%q", queryPos)
		return
	}
	filename, offset := queryPos[:colon], queryPos[colon+1:]
	startOffset := -1
	endOffset := -1
	if hyphen := strings.Index(offset, ","); hyphen < 0 {
		// e.g. "foo.go:#123"
		startOffset = parseOctothorpDecimal(offset)
		endOffset = startOffset
	} else {
		// e.g. "foo.go:#123,#456"
		startOffset = parseOctothorpDecimal(offset[:hyphen])
		endOffset = parseOctothorpDecimal(offset[hyphen+1:])
	}
	if startOffset < 0 || endOffset < 0 {
		err = fmt.Errorf("invalid -pos offset %q", offset)
		return
	}

	var file *token.File
	fset.Iterate(func(f *token.File) bool {
		if sameFile(filename, f.Name()) {
			// (f.Name() is absolute)
			file = f
			return false // done
		}
		return true // continue
	})
	if file == nil {
		err = fmt.Errorf("couldn't find file containing position -pos=%q", queryPos)
		return
	}

	// Range check [start..end], inclusive of both end-points.

	if 0 <= startOffset && startOffset <= file.Size() {
		start = file.Pos(int(startOffset))
	} else {
		err = fmt.Errorf("start position is beyond end of file -pos=%q", queryPos)
		return
	}

	if 0 <= endOffset && endOffset <= file.Size() {
		end = file.Pos(int(endOffset))
	} else {
		err = fmt.Errorf("end position is beyond end of file -pos=%q", queryPos)
		return
	}

	return
}

// Init prepares the scanner s to tokenize the text src by setting the
// scanner at the beginning of src. The scanner uses the file set file
// for position information and it adds line information for each line.
// It is ok to re-use the same file when re-scanning the same file as
// line information which is already present is ignored. Init causes a
// panic if the file size does not match the src size.
//
// Calls to Scan will invoke the error handler err if they encounter a
// syntax error and err is not nil. Also, for each error encountered,
// the Scanner field ErrorCount is incremented by one. The mode parameter
// determines how comments are handled.
//
// Note that Init may call err if there is an error in the first character
// of the file.
//
func (s *Scanner) Init(file *token.File, src []byte, err ErrorHandler, mode Mode) {
	// Explicitly initialize all fields since a scanner may be reused.
	if file.Size() != len(src) {
		panic(fmt.Sprintf("file size (%d) does not match src len (%d)", file.Size(), len(src)))
	}
	s.file = file
	s.dir, _ = filepath.Split(file.Name())
	s.src = src
	s.err = err
	s.mode = mode

	s.ch = ' '
	s.offset = 0
	s.rdOffset = 0
	s.lineOffset = 0
	s.insertSemi = false
	s.ErrorCount = 0

	s.next()
}

// TODO(adonovan): make this a method: func (*token.File) Contains(token.Pos)
func tokenFileContainsPos(f *token.File, pos token.Pos) bool {
	p := int(pos)
	base := f.Base()
	return base <= p && p < base+f.Size()
}
